[問題] 從一組SET中互相比較選最好的問題已回收

看板MATLAB作者時間16年前 (2009/09/03 22:20), 編輯推噓0(000)
留言0則, 0人參與, 最新討論串1/1
假設有一組五個數值 先從當中取出norm 最大的 放在所需的user set中 after selecting i user, the i+1 user ise selected among the user set 也就是說 我們現在要選第二個所需的user 選的方法是拿其他四個來跟第一個做內積再取絕對值看會不會滿足這個絕對值大於 某一個constraint 會的話就留下來 形成一個set 再從這個set當中取norm最大的當作second desire user 而我的問題出在第三個user 第三個set中的user要同時跟前面兩個選出來的user都滿足內積大於constraint 也就是例如說 有1 2 3 4 5 五個user step1 choose 2 step2 拿 1 3 4 5 跟2 作內積有滿足的假設是3 4 5 再從345中取最好的 4 step3 拿 1 3 5 跟2 4 兩個都做內積都要滿足 假設只有3滿足 就選3 最後的user set 就是 2 4 3 重點是還要記得他是本來的第幾個user step3 我實在想不出怎麼寫迴圈 謝謝 -- -- ※ 發信站: 批踢踢實業坊(ptt.cc) ◆ From: 122.120.35.116 ※ 編輯: mrchildren3 來自: 122.120.35.116 (09/03 22:23)
文章代碼(AID): #1Adz2aOw (MATLAB)
文章代碼(AID): #1Adz2aOw (MATLAB)